In May, the average temperature is usually around 64°F. August is typically the warmest month in Rome, when it usually averages around 86°F. You can expect the least rain in July. The coldest month is January, with temperatures averaging 41°F. The rainiest month is November.

Rome airports to Rome proper: the nitty-gritty travel tips.

Rome has two airports: Rome Ciampino and Rome Fiumicino; the latter of which is the most common airport destination. To travel from Fiumicino (FCO) to Rome proper, the most popular option is the Leonardo Express Airport Train, which gets you to Termini Station, and the center of Rome, in 30 minutes. The train runs every 30 minutes. The Leonardo Express isn't the cheapest option, however--that honor belongs to the Terravision bus, which takes twice as long as the express train, is a third of the cost and doesn't run as frequently.
